My story

Here's what the humans have to say about me:


I got Slinky from Treehouse Humane Society at the end of August last year. He’s a little over 2 years old. He was found on the streets with trouble seeing out of his left eye, and it eventually had to be removed. That said, since he’s a pretty active cat he doesn’t let his poor vision stop him from getting around! There was one cat already living in the apartment at the time I got Slinky, and unfortunately they are still not getting along. While I think he would benefit from another playmate, I think he should be in a single cat household that could eventually introduce another cat.
He is also FeLV positive, so he requires more medical attention than other cats. He loves playing and being around people and so requires a lot of attention and supervision. He can get pretty chatty if you don’t play with him enough, so having a routine with set playtime will help him chill out. He would do best in a cleanly household where he cannot get into any food left out or trash cans/recycling.
